In my opinion in out stations it's complicated by the fact that check in counters are not owned by the airlines but pay for them on a hourly rate in some cases. The same with the staff. It's easier for the handling staff to check in all the passengers and baggage and close the flight and vacate the counters or reduce the number of counters open if they have a huge delay.
But I agree with you in that if they inform you then they should respect and expect passengers would come in time for the check in for the new departure time.
